  • Teacher of the Week: Kendra Parker 
    Reported by: Andy Justus

    Monday, Feb 16, 2009 @01:13pm CST

        Amarillo-- Carver Early Childhood Academy Teacher Picks up Weekly Award.

        Kendra Parker is a 1st grade teacher at the Carver Early Childhood Academy.  Nikki Cobb calls her "the nicest teacher ever."
        Take a look at the Nikki's nomination Letter:

    I want Mrs. Parker to be teacher of the week because she smells sweet. She is the nicest teacher ever. She helps me read. If we're stuck, she helps us figure it out. Even though we act bad and we have to move our clips, she still loves us even if we act bad. Every time its Friday she lets us do Fun Friday centers. She has taught me about Sam Houston, Abraham Lincoln, the war, how to count by 2's and 10's and 5's. She taught us how to do a timeline. She loves me and she thinks I'm smart. I will always love her. She is the best.Name: Nikki Cobb, 1st grade student at Carver Early Childhood Academy
